<p>Not long after I got my snowblower, the top of the plastic cable protector broke off. I designed a replacement protector with similar dimensions. The first time I tried printing, I did not have good adhesion and the print failed at the top. Using larger brim helps and recommend slowing the printer down to 50-75% when approaching the top of the print (i.e., after 2 hours). The original cable protector is domed, and thus needs to be printed with the dome at the top. Alternatively, I've provided a model with a flat top that can be printed upside down, with the flat top on the base. Either way you will likely need a brim.</p><p>You cannot print this lying horizontally. I tried with an octagonal version, but it was no good.</p><p>I used fuzzy skin in PrusaSlicer/Cura. I think it makes this look better.</p><p>I printed this in PLA, though I suspect PETG might be a better choice in the long run.</p><h4>Print settings:</h4><ul><li><strong>PLA</strong></li><li><strong>Layer heigh</strong>t, variable, 0.2mm</li><li><strong>Infill </strong>n/a (left at 20%)</li><li><strong>Brim</strong>, inner and outer 7mm</li><li><strong>Fuzzy skin</strong> option</li></ul><p>Designed with OpenScad.</p><p>&nbsp;</p>
